Q: Is 34,732,444 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 34,732,444 is not a prime number.

Why is 34,732,444 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 34732444 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 179 271 358 542 716 1,084 32,041 48,509 64,082 97,018 128,164 194,036 8,683,111 17,366,222 and 34,732,444, with no remainder.

Since 34,732,444 cannot be divided by just 1 and 34,732,444, it is not a prime number.
